A Prayer for the World


Let the rain come and wash away
the ancient grudges, the bitter hatreds
held and nurtured over generations.
Let the rain wash away the memory
of the hurt, the neglect.
Then let the sun come out and
fill the sky with rainbows.
Let the warmth of the Sun heal us
wherever we are broken.
Let it burn away the fog so that
we can see beyond labels,
beyond accents, gender, or skin color.
Let the warmth and brightness
of the Sun melt our selfishness.
So that we can share the joys and
feel the sorrows of our neighbors.
And let the light of the Sun
be so strong that we will see all
people as our neighbors.
Let the Earth, nourished by rain,
bring forth flowers
to surround us with beauty.
And let the mountains teach our hearts
to reach upward to heaven. 

                             - Rabbi Harold S. Kushner

Journey of the Universe

 

The Journey of the Universe, an award-winning PBS film, guides us through a new epic story - the ways our stars, planets and living organisms emerged within the vast drama of the universe.  It is the beautiful story of US and our CHILDREN and - CHILDREN'S CHILDREN; something no previous generation knew. This compelling film takes us from the origins of life to our present ecological and social challenges.  It is now being shown world-wide.

 

Evolutionary philosopher Brian Swimme explores
cosmic and Earth evolution (through cosmology, astronomy, geology, biology, history and ecology) - as a profound process of creativity, connection and interdependence.  The producers use the cutting edge of science to interweave the traditional role of creation stories - to explore "where we came from." It is a story of the past that speaks to our future.

Book Groups reading The New Jim Crow

Two  groups are meeting weekly in the church office to discuss The New Jim Crow by Michelle Alexander.  One group meets on Sunday at 1:00 PM, and the other on Tuesday at 6:30 PM. This book is an expertly written in-depth study of the histori- cal, documented causes of racism in our society, leading to it's tragic consequences of the mass incarceration of African Americans.  A chapter a week is read in preparation for the meeting.  Our final discussion will be together with Asbury United Methodist Church.  See the video below for Michelle Alexander's summary of her book.

From Interfaith Power and Light
Urging our Maryland Legislature to commit to 40% clean energy by 2025

Clergy & Faith Leaders support
clean energy
Last week, we joyfully announced that over 230 clergy and faith leaders across the state of Maryland stood in support of expanding the state's renewable energy standard through the Maryland Clean Energy Advancement Act. An incredible thanks to all the clergy and lay leaders who made this possible! Then, we sat together during the Senate Finance Committee hearing of the bill to make sure our representatives know that our faith communities call them to do right on climate for the sake of our neighbors in Maryland, across the US, and around the world.   
 
Rev. Ryan Sirmons (R. on above photo) and Rev. Dr. Wayne Schwandt were among those 230+ who signed a letter of support for 40% clean energy.

Creation Spirituality Communities


is a network of communities ranging from intentional groups to alternative churches, which are grounded in the tenants of Creation Spirituality and revere the sacredness of all creation. Through study, ritual, celebration and action, these communities support justice, compassion, transformation and sustainability for the Universe and for all living beings.  It is both tradition and movement, celebrated by mystics and agents of social change from every age and culture.  Our online community, Chesapeake Creation Spirituality Community, is waiting for you to join.
